Mobile-Ready Emails 

Use email templates that are mobile-ready whenever you send an email. Your email marketing campaigns should not be only viewable from a PC or laptop, but optimized for mobile use with smartphones and tablet computers as well. If you aren’t sure if it is mobile ready, pull up your email campaign with your mobile phone and see how it looks. This is the easiest way to determine if it should be adjusted or not. Many people read emails from their phone or tablet, so this is a must.

Mobile-Optimized Website

Of course your manufacturing website also needs to be ready for mobile use. It is easy to convert your regular website, or a portion of it, to be optimized for mobile use. Get help from your webmaster if you don’t create your own website. The main landing pages of your site should be optimized for mobile use, particularly your homepage and contact page.
